Problem 1A. Factorial
该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。
Problem 1A. Factorial
时间限制:1000ms
空间限制:256MB
题目描述
给定正整数 \(x\) ,请给出 \(x!\) 的值。
其中 \(x!\) 代表 \(x\) 的阶乘,一个正整数的阶乘(factorial)是所有小于及等于该数的正整数的积。
例如 \(4! = 1 \times 2 \times 3 \times 4 = 24\)
注意:本题包含多组询问
输入格式
第一行输入一个正整数 \(T\),代表询问组数。
下面 \(T\) 行每行一个正整数 \(x\) ,代表询问计算阶乘的正整数。
输出格式
输出 \(T\) 行,每行一个整数,代表当前询问的结果 \(x!\)。
由于结果可能很大,请输出 \(x!\) 对 998244353 取模的结果。
样例输入
3
10
25
100
样例输出
3628800
254940118
35305197
数据规模与约定
对于 \(60\%\) 的数据,\(T=1\)
对于 \(100\%\) 的数据,\(1 \le T \le 10^5\),\(1 \le x \le 10^6\)